Big Lake Bob's links will show you the selling prices of the top 10 for each day. If you want to view the other prices (and you don't want to give them your email and a password), another way I found was to view the YouTube recordings of the auctions. I look through the catalog online, find the lot numbers I am interested in, then fast forward on the video to see what it hammers for. As an example, I was interested in what a 1941 Indian 4 sold for.
In the catalog it shows it sold and says it is lot S126.1.

That one Crocker was a put together bike, thus low price. Triumphs were really soft. The one lone dirt XR 750 Harley sold for 55k, almost double the typical price for a 1980. I took advantage of the soft Triumph market this year, bought a nice 67 Triumph framer dirt bike. Gonna change some things and make it mine. Was there for all 4 days, what a great time!
